AES加密时jdk1.6,jdk1.7, jdk1.8需要替换的jar
2021-12-20 11:02:24 26KB AES加密
1
AES加密算法c语言实现代码
2021-12-17 22:16:45 65KB AES
1
Delphi AES加密算法实例程序,包括了加密算法的接口应用,包含 2 个过程和 2 个字符加密函数,支持 128 位密匙加密和解密字符串。重新修改加密模式,支持 128、192 和 256 位密匙加密。   改动函数参数表,添加 KeyBit 参数。但是可以不带此参数,默认情况按照 128 位操作。   添加了新例程,支持对流和文件的操作。   ElASE.pas 单元封装是一个 AES 加密算法的标准接口。作者:杨泽晖,支持 128 / 192 / 256 位的密匙,默认情况下按照 128 位密匙操作。
2021-12-17 12:42:56 46KB Delphi源码-加密解密
1
本文实例为大家分享了python实现AES加密解密的具体代码,供大家参考,具体内容如下 (1)对于AES加密解密相关知识 (2)实现的功能就是输入0-16个字符,然后经过AES的加密解密最后可以得到原先的输入,运行的结果如下 开始的字符串就是输入的明文,第一个矩阵,是明文对应的状态矩阵,下面的字典是得到的经过扩展后的密钥,再下面的矩阵是经过加密之后的矩阵,最后的矩阵就是解密之后的矩阵,最后的输出就是还原的明文,可以发现AES加密解密的过程没毛病。 (3)字节代换:输入输出都是十六进制的矩阵格式,define_byte_subdtitution()函数的功能是完成字节代换,首先使用hex_t
2021-12-16 15:41:00 99KB aes加密 last num
1
第一种 import base64 from Crypto.Cipher import AES # 密钥(key), 密斯偏移量(iv) CBC模式加密 def AES_Encrypt(key, data): vi = '0102030405060708' pad = lambda s: s + (16 - len(s) ) * chr(16 - len(s) ) data = pad(data) # 字符串补位 cipher = AES.new(key.encode('utf8'), AES.MODE_CBC, vi.encode('utf8'))
2021-12-16 15:38:12 44KB 加密 方法
1
基于openssl,从命令行接受参数3个字符串类型的参数:参数1, 参数2, 参数3。 参数1=enc表示加密, 参数1=dec表示解密;参数2为待加密、 解密的文件名;参数3为密码。
2021-12-15 20:56:49 2.85MB AES openssl 文件
1
[iOS]AES加密在iOS上面的实现 播客文章:http://blog.csdn.net/z251257144/article/details/8233385
2021-12-13 16:14:31 54KB iOS,AES
1
AES加密方式有五种 : ECB, CBC, CTR, CFB, OFB 从安全性角度推荐cbc算法 windows 下安装 : pip install pycryptodome linux 下安装 : pip install pycrypto cbc加密需要一个十六位的key 和一个十六位的iv(偏移量) ecb加密不需要iv aes cbc 加密的python实现 from Crypto.Cipher import AES from binascii import b2a_hex, a2b_hex # 如果text不足十六位的倍数用空格补充 def add_to_16(text):
2021-12-13 13:39:21 39KB c crypt nc
1
AES_ECB加密解密源码,包含base64编码解码 可在VS工程中直接验证,test中包含测试代码,包含两种填充方式
2021-12-10 19:28:10 7.92MB AES加密 AES填充ZeroPaddin
1
主要介绍了java使用Hex编码解码实现Aes加密解密功能,结合完整实例形式分析了Aes加密解密功能的定义与使用方法,需要的朋友可以参考下
2021-12-09 19:16:49 50KB java Hex 编码 解码
1